Happurg, Bavaria, Germany

Overview

Happurg is a picturesque Bavarian village set amidst rolling hills and by the serene Happurger See lake. Known for outdoor recreation and its tranquil rural charm, the town makes a relaxing getaway from urban life. Despite its small size, visitors find a welcoming atmosphere and easy access to nature.

Best Time to Visit

May-September for warm weather and lake activities; December for traditional Christmas events.

Local Tips

Cash is commonly used in small shops and restaurants. Public transport is limited, so consider renting a car or using local buses for flexibility.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ping 5-10% is appreciated. Dress is generally casual but respectful in churches and restaurants. A friendly greeting ('Grüß Gott') is customary.

Safety Warnings

Happurg is very safe with minimal crime. Exercise routine caution for belongings, especially near the lake during busy weekends.

Hidden Gems

Hiking up to Hohlenstein Cave for panoramic views, visiting the Roman quarry ruins, and exploring little-known forest trails around Deckersberg.
